site stats

Ef core filtered index

WebMar 26, 2024 · The simplest way to add an index is to by adding the [Index] attribute on the model class and specifying which columns should be included in the index. Here’s an example of adding an index with a single column: using Microsoft.EntityFrameworkCore; using System.ComponentModel.DataAnnotations; [Index (nameof (Name)) ] public class … WebDec 21, 2015 · After discussion on #11846, we decided that the way to handle this is to allow multiple named indexes to be created over columns, while still preserving the current semantics (i.e. addressing by ordered property set) for unnamed indexes.. Original issue: Add support for column sort order to migrations, metadata, and reverse engineering. Add …

Create filtered indexes - SQL Server Microsoft Learn

WebApr 10, 2024 · Note. Here you are calling the Where method on an IQueryable object, and the filter will be processed on the server. In some scenarios you might be calling the Where method as an extension method on an in-memory collection. (For example, suppose you change the reference to _context.Students so that instead of an EF DbSet it references a … WebI know that the original post referred to the 6.1 version of EF, but after some research I have found a way to add an extension method for filtered indexes to the fluent api of EF Core … nature of things wasted https://mondo-lirondo.com

What

WebMar 26, 2024 · The simplest way to add an index is to by adding the [Index] attribute on the model class and specifying which columns should be included in the index. Here’s an example of adding an index with a … WebFastest Entity Framework Extensions. Indexes are a common concept across many data stores, and data is stored in the form of records. Every record has a key field, which helps it to be recognized uniquely. Indexing is a way to optimize a database's performance by minimizing the number of disk accesses required when a query is processed. WebAug 7, 2024 · In Entity Framework Core 5, "filtered include" feature is finally scheduled to be released. Now, we need some love for ForeignKey attribute as well. It would be great if I can do something like the following with the ForeignKey attribute. I believe implementing this feature is easily doable using the "filtered include" feature. nature of time management

SaveChanges circular dependency in unique filtered index …

Category:Eager Loading of Related Data - EF Core Microsoft Learn

Tags:Ef core filtered index

Ef core filtered index

EF Core Providers - Indexes ef-core-providers Tutorial

WebApr 10, 2024 · Note. Here you are calling the Where method on an IQueryable object, and the filter will be processed on the server. In some scenarios you might be calling the … WebJul 2, 2024 · This “EF Core In depth” series is inspired by what I found while updating my book “Entity Framework Core in Action” to cover EF Core 5. I am also added a LOT of …

Ef core filtered index

Did you know?

WebMay 26, 2024 · #3: Filtering and data manipulation only on the server-side. After you read the previous problem, you might get the wrong idea and think that any data operation should be done solely on the MSSQL ... WebNov 12, 2013 · What You Can do in a Filtered Index…. Use equality or inequality operators, such as =, >=, <, and more in the WHERE clause. Use IN to create an index for a range of values. (This can support a query that does an “OR” – read about “OR” and “IN” with filtered indexes here .) Create multiple filtered indexes on one column.

WebMay 20, 2024 · roji changed the title Unexpected cycles detected by BatchingTopologicalSort in latest preview SaveChanges circular dependency in unique filtered index on Nov 21, 2024. roji mentioned this issue on Nov 21, 2024. SaveChanges circular dependency in unique unfiltered index #29647. Closed. WebIndexing in EF Core. By convention, an index is created in each property (or set of properties) that are used as a foreign key. ... .HasName("Index_Name"); } Index Filter. …

WebIndexing in EF Core. By convention, an index is created in each property (or set of properties) that are used as a foreign key. ... .HasName("Index_Name"); } Index Filter. In some relational databases, you can specify a filtered or partial index to index only a subset of a column's values, reducing the index's size and improving both ... WebJan 9, 2024 · EF Core version: 2.0.1 Database Provider: Microsoft.EntityFrameworkCore.SqlServer ... AndriySvyryd changed the title Allow direct access to discriminators' value using Fluent Api Add discriminator filter for unique index on derived type Mar 3, 2024. AndriySvyryd removed the priority-stretch label Mar 3, …

WebSep 28, 2015 · The filtered index must be a nonclustered index on a table. Creates filtered statistics for the data rows in the filtered index. The filter predicate uses simple comparison logic and cannot reference a computed column, a UDT column, a spatial data type column, or a hierarchyID data type column. Comparisons using NULL literals are not allowed ...

WebNov 18, 2024 · Non-unique indexes. Filtered indexes can be non-unique, whereas indexed views must be unique. Filtered indexes are defined on one table and only support simple comparison operators. If you need a filter expression that references multiple tables or has complex logic, you should create a view. Filtered indexes don't support LIKE operators. nature of thrift banksWebThe Entity Framework Core Fluent API HasIndex method is used to create a database index on the column mapped to the specified entity property. By default, indexes are created for foreign keys and alternate keys. You may wish to create indexes on other properties to speed up data retrieval: This will result in a non-unique index being created. nature of things with david suzukiWebFeb 18, 2024 · After this, I'm going to find special row that I need by some conditions. I hope to have a growth of performance after setting the index. I saw this issue. But I don't understand how to set partial index for current npgsql version. I use .Net Core 3.1, all packages have the last version. Current npgsql version is 3.1.1.2. marine reach nzWebASP.NET Core Web API + EF Core - Recommended way to check all unique constraints on a POST? I've just started trying out EF Core and have ran into something that google doesn't immediately answer. If you let VS auto create an API Controller with actions using Entity Framework, most of the methods check for things like if the record exists ... nature of tinikling danceWebFeb 23, 2024 · To install the tool locally for each solution, we first need to create a tool manifest. From the solution folder, we can run the following dotnet command. dotnet new … marine ready for tasking readiness metricWebJan 19, 2024 · The following example loads all blogs, their related posts, and the author of each post. C#. using (var context = new BloggingContext ()) { var blogs = context.Blogs .Include (blog => blog.Posts) .ThenInclude (post => post.Author) .ToList (); } You can chain multiple calls to ThenInclude to continue including further levels of related data. marine reading programWebSep 16, 2015 · 22. Filtered indexes can be tricky. Just getting your queries to use the filtered index can be a real pain. Parameterization may mean it’s “unsafe” to use the filtered index. The optimizer might want the filtered column in your key or include column list when it doesn’t seem like it should have to be there. The weather might be cloudy. nature of thinking in psychology